Launch Roundup: NASA’s PACE mission, Chinese art satellites, and more Starlink missions
February started with two Chinese launches. On Feb. 2, a Long March 2C rocket launched from the Xichang Satellite Launch Centre in China at 23:37 UTC, carrying 11 satellites for a Geely Constellation. APStar, Yaogan, and Shiyan payloads lift off from China
China has launched two more missions to orbit, bringing its launch count in January to four launches already. First, a Chang Zheng 2C launched from the Xichang Satellite Launch Center (XSLC) on Thursday at 18:10 UTC, carrying APStar-6E.
